Costco's 15.76 Billion Trading Volume Lands 28th in Market Ranking
On April 28, 2025, Costco's trading volume reached 15.76 billion, ranking 28th in the day's stock market. CostcoCOST-- (COST) rose 0.14%, marking two consecutive days of gains, with a total increase of 0.31% over the past two days.
